    This mod is similar to Alternating Turn Signal/Side Markers (#27), but doesn't use relays!

    From what I can tell the side markers blink with the turn signals when they are off, and opposite of the turn signals when the parking lights are turned on. I'm not sure yet as I haven't done it yet. Will post up after I try it.







    Parts:
    • 2 pieces of wire
    • 2 butt connectors
    • 2 quick splices
    • shrink tube, electrical tape, etc
    Just cut the black/white wire on the side marker and splice it into the Red/black on left. For the right cut the black/white and splice to red/yellow.

    Like this:
    th_SignalsNSideMarkersJungleman_1eef68f564f3917483852a3daf275a0fa7f32edc.jpg

    Original thread here:
    Another way to get side-markers to blink? - Toyota Forums :: Toyota Nation
    Thanks to Jungleman for trying it, and others for their contributions! [​IMG]

    Edit: Lights on-alternating, lights off-synchronized.

    Just did this on my 09 DCLB TRD Sport Prerunner. Works great, except that the left wire to splice onto at the DTRL is YELLOW, and the right is GREEN. Other than that, looks good. An additional benny is that when the four-way flashers are on, the front alternates turn lights to parking lights. That'll get someone's attention!     When I did mine, I wired a relay in parallel with the turn signal. When the flasher flashes, the relay energizes and the side markers go OFF. When the flasher turns off, the side marker comes back ON.
